Diagonal drywall cracks above door frames are a common occurrence in new construction, and in many cases, they are a normal part of the home’s adjustment process. As a new home settles, the underlying soil compacts under the weight of the structure, and framing lumber may shrink as it dries. Because door frames interrupt the continuity of wall framing, these areas become stress concentration points where cracks are most likely to appear.
However, it is important to distinguish between normal settling and potential structural issues. You can evaluate the severity of these cracks using the following criteria:
- Cosmetic Cracks: Hairline fractures less than 1/16 inch wide are typically normal. These are often stable and do not affect the operation of doors or windows.
- Moderate Cracks: Cracks between 1/16 and 1/4 inch may indicate minor foundation settlement or seasonal soil movement, especially in areas with expansive clay soils like Centennial and the Front Range.
- Structural Warning Signs: Cracks wider than 1/4 inch, or those accompanied by sticking doors, sloping floors, and exterior stair-step cracks in brick mortar, often point to active foundation settlement that requires professional attention.
In our region, expansive clay soils swell with moisture and shrink during dry periods, which can accelerate uneven movement. We recommend monitoring any cracks by measuring their width and length monthly. If you notice progressive growth over 30 to 60 days or visible shifting of the door frame, it is time for a professional assessment.
